Output 59ef302ba3733ddf82ec653761df95be65d4ee4b9139bb790b9a391db0fda5e0:1

value
3260134
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bbab53fac05b590103ba624af065a8b242129b30 OP_EQUALVERIFY OP_CHECKSIG
address
1J7JbxJiQJDhJdqDETHNP4byvNu41HYr8W
transaction
59ef302ba3733ddf82ec653761df95be65d4ee4b9139bb790b9a391db0fda5e0
spent
true